Industrial Safety Issues at Tashkent Customs Warehouses Discussed at Seminar
2025-10-27 14:00:00 / News

During the seminar, special attention was given to technical regulations, normative documents, and safety measures that must be followed when storing, transporting, and using flammable and explosive chemical substances. Participants received practical guidance on preventing accidents and fires, ensuring safe working conditions, conducting regular inspections of control and measuring equipment, and responding effectively to emergencies.
Representatives of the territorial administration noted that some customs warehouses operating in Tashkent are not yet registered in the “ekotizim.cirns.uz” information system. As a result, additional inspections are planned to assess the safety levels and legal compliance of these facilities.
According to officials of the Committee, warehouses not included in the “ekotizim.cirns.uz” platform will be subjected to inspections based on the “risk analysis” mechanism. These inspections will comprehensively assess the technical condition of each facility, the state of its safety infrastructure, fire prevention systems, and procedures for storing chemical substances.
At the end of the seminar, entrepreneurs were provided with recommendations on eliminating existing deficiencies, strengthening the culture of industrial safety, and legally registering their operations in relevant information systems.
